Description

Editorial information: Publications Center of the Technical General Secretariat of the Spanish Ministry of Economic Affairs and Digital Transformation.

This third version of the guidelines focuses on the UNE-EN 301 549:202022 standard and the Implementing Decision (EU) 2021/1339, as well as the new market tools for reviewing accessibility in mobile applications. 

The guidelines has been designed to help developers and evaluators of mobile applications (APPs) in terms of accessibility, especially considering that, from the application of the aforementioned directive, companies that work for the public sector will have the obligation to create accessible mobile applications.

This  guidelines aims to help to generate native mobile applications accessible for the main operating systems on the market (Android, iOS andWindows), as well as evaluate their level of accessibility, being able to detect and correct possible barriers  to users with disabilities. Furthermore, the contents described can be used to apply continuous improvement (multiple iterations of evaluation and subsequent correction), which will make it even easier for any user (regardless of their abilities) to use the target application.
